Legendary Afrobeat musician Femi Kuti is back with his eleventh studio album, Journey Through Life — a powerful, rhythmic offering that captures the essence of personal growth, family, and resilience.

In a recent conversation with OkayAfrica, Femi opened up about the inspiration behind the album and the deeply personal themes that shape it.

Journey Through Life is not just a musical experience — it’s an emotional voyage.

Drawing from his own life, Femi reflects on the trials, triumphs, and teachings passed down through generations of the Kuti family.

The album channels the activist spirit of his father, the late Fela Kuti, while embracing more introspective, reflective tones that speak to Femi’s own evolution as a man and musician.

"The album is about moving through the highs and lows of life, but always pushing forward," Femi shared in the interview.

He credits much of his musical motivation to his family — both the legacy he’s inherited and the one he continues to build with his own children, including fellow musician Made Kuti.

The project weaves together vibrant horns, political consciousness, and raw emotion, staying true to Afrobeat’s roots while allowing space for personal storytelling.

Tracks explore themes like self-discovery, unity, perseverance, and the importance of staying grounded in one’s values.

As the world continues to navigate complex times, Journey Through Life offers a timely reminder of music’s power to heal, inspire, and connect.

For Femi, this album is more than just a release — it’s a reflection of where he’s been, where he is, and where he’s going.
